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Conservative Balance SheetZero debt in 2025 and minimal historical leverage provide durable financial flexibility. This reduces default risk, lowers fixed financial costs, and preserves capacity to fund investments or return capital during downturns, supporting long-term resilience and strategic optionality.
Recent Revenue And Margin RecoveryA sustained recovery with ~7% revenue growth and ~11% net margin in 2025 signals improved operating performance and product-market fit. If maintained, these trends support reinvestment, stable operating cash flow, and stronger returns on capital versus recent loss periods.
Rebounded Cash GenerationPositive operating and free cash flow in 2025 that roughly matches reported earnings shows the business can convert profits to cash. Sustainable cash conversion underpins dividend capacity, deleveraging or growth investments without relying on external financing.
Bears Say
Earnings And Cash-Flow VolatilityMulti-year swings including a loss year and intermittent negative operating cash flow indicate underlying earnings cyclicality or working-capital sensitivity. This reduces predictability for planning, raises required return for investors, and makes capital allocation riskier over time.
Limited ScaleA very small employee base suggests limited scale and narrower operational bandwidth. Smaller scale can constrain product development, geographic expansion and internal controls, and increases vulnerability to key-person departures, which can hinder durable growth execution.
Low Trading LiquidityLow average trading volume implies persistent liquidity constraints for shareholders and potential higher transaction costs. Structurally low liquidity can deter institutional holders, limit price discovery and increase financing friction for equity raises or secondary transactions.

                    Company Description

                    Sino AG

                    Sino AG, headquartered in Düsseldorf, Germany, specializes in providing digital equity trading services across the German market. The firm offers a suite of advanced trading platforms, prominently featuring sino MX-PRO, which grants users connectivity to a wide array of approximately 40 stock exchanges. Originally established in 1998, the company previously operated under the name sino Wertpapierhandelsgesellschaft mbH.
